I could not believe how easy it was after all the heartache filled stories of terrible messes that kids have left all over the house like un housebroken pups. It was Thursday morning and Ian asks me as we are watching a morning of Curious George that he wants to go pee pee in the potty. I took a double take and realized from his dead pan face he was very serious.
I got up and 75% expected that this would be a disaster. He climbed on top of the potty and let it rip....the pee that is. He did this all day asking and then successfully peeing on the potty.
After each success, we did a high five and I would comment on what a big boy he was at 2 and a half yrs old. We called his grandma Shaw that night who also shared in the enthusiasm. She was so impressed in fact that she offered to buy his some big boy underwear. Since Ian is a Super Hero fanatic, his underwear shared that theme. Pooping is the next hurdle now. He asks for Diapers to poop in so we will see how long it takes till his logs appear in the potty.
